BIO 235 - General Anatomy & Physiology I (4 credit hours) Offered in Fall, Winter Terms (3-2-0) An introduction to the principles of biology covering the structure and function of the skeletal, muscular, nervous and sensory systems. PREREQUISITE(S): No prerequisite but high school biology or college level biology is highly recommended. GENERAL EDUCATION DISTRIBUTION AREA: Science NOTE: BIO 235 and BIO 236 together are designed to provide a complete overview of human biology. For this reason Anatomy and Physiology should be considered as a two-semester course to be taken in sequence. Lecture and Lab. Master Syllabi: http://www.ncmich.edu/master_syllabi/content/index.php
